com.partnersoft.gui
Class FlexibleCellRenderer

java.lang.Object
  extended by com.partnersoft.gui.FlexibleCellRenderer
All Implemented Interfaces:
javax.swing.table.TableCellRenderer

public class FlexibleCellRenderer
extends java.lang.Object
implements javax.swing.table.TableCellRenderer

A TableCellRenderer that returns components based on the value's class.

Author:
Paul Reavis Copyright 2001 Partner Software, Inc.

Constructor Summary
FlexibleCellRenderer()
           
 
Method Summary
 java.awt.Component getTableCellRendererComponent(javax.swing.JTable table, java.lang.Object value, boolean isSelected, boolean hasFocus, int row, int column)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

FlexibleCellRenderer

public FlexibleCellRenderer()
Method Detail

getTableCellRendererComponent

public java.awt.Component getTableCellRendererComponent(javax.swing.JTable table,
                                                        java.lang.Object value,
                                                        boolean isSelected,
                                                        boolean hasFocus,
                                                        int row,
                                                        int column)
Specified by:
getTableCellRendererComponent in interface javax.swing.table.TableCellRenderer